How do you develop a test plan and schedule? Describe
bottom-up and top-down approaches.
Answer Posted / subhan.qa
we are not going to develop test plan document. test lead is
going to prepare test plan documents.bottom up and top down
approaches are used for integration testing.in top down
approach we are connecting main module with submodules in
the place of remaining under constructive sub modules we
will use stubs. in bottom up approach in the place of under
constructive main module we will use a temporary program
call ed driver
